Dual UART (DUART) with integrated parallel printer port
Category: Integrated Circuits (ICs) | Interface UARTs
Package/case: 68-PLCC (24.23 x 24.23 mm), J-lead LCC, surface mount
Supplier device package: 68-PLCC (24.23 x 24.23 mm)
Supply voltage: 4.75 V to 5.25 V (5 V nominal)
Max data rate: 1 Mbps
FIFOs: 16-byte TX and RX per channel
Modem control and false start-bit detection for reliable serial communication
RoHS3 compliant, lead-free G4 variant
Base product number: TL16C

Equivalent or alternative models
- Texas Instruments TL16C552AFNR (same function, 68-PLCC, tape & reel; different ordering suffix)
- Texas Instruments TL16C552AFN (same function, 68-PLCC, tube packaging)
- Texas Instruments TL16C2552 family (dual UART variants; features and pinouts differ—verify compatibility)
- NXP/Philips SCC2692 (dual UART, typically 5 V; functional alternative, not pin-compatible)
- MaxLinear/Exar XR16C2552 (dual UART; functional alternative, voltage/pinout may differ)
- NXP SC16C852 (dual UART, often 3.3 V; functional alternative, not drop-in)
